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 5 ACMG points: 6P and 1B. PM1PM2PM5BP4

The NM_001199107.2(TBC1D24):ā€‹c.441C>Gā€‹(p.Asp147Glu)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000000686 in 1,457,296 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ar.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. D147N)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
TBC1D24 (HGNC:29203): (TBC1 domain family member 24) This gene encodes a protein with a conserved domain, referred to as the TBC domain, characteristic of proteins which interact with GTPases. TBC domain proteins may serve as GTPase-activating proteins for a particular group of GTPases, the Rab (Ras-related proteins in brain) small GTPases which are involved in the regulation of membrane trafficking. Mutations in this gene are associated with familial infantile myoclonic epilepsy.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Feb 2011]
